Who funds Ohio Voice?
Ohio Voice is funded by 57 grantmakers, led by The George Gund Foundation ($2.7M), Tides Foundation ($2.0M), State Voices ($1.7M).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$13.0M in grants to Ohio Voice between 2019–2025.
